Mold Control in Plano, TX

Mold control services focus on identifying and eliminating mold growth within residential properties. These services typically address issues such as visible mold patches, musty odors, and moisture problems that can contribute to mold development. Projects may include mold inspection, moisture assessment, removal of affected materials, and thorough cleaning to prevent future growth. Homeowners often seek mold control when experiencing health concerns related to mold exposure or after water damage, leaks, or high humidity conditions that create an environment conducive to mold growth.

Before requesting mold control services, property owners should understand the extent of the mold issue, including whether it is confined to a small area or widespread throughout the property. It is also helpful to know the sources of moisture that may be fueling the mold problem, such as leaks or poor ventilation. Clarifying the scope of work and any necessary repairs can ensure that the project addresses both the visible mold and underlying causes, supporting a healthier indoor environment.

Common Mold Control Jobs

Mold remediation - removal of existing mold growth from affected areas to improve indoor air quality.

Mold prevention - implementing strategies to inhibit mold growth before it becomes a problem.

Water damage repair - addressing leaks and moisture issues that can lead to mold development.

HVAC mold control - cleaning and maintaining ductwork to prevent mold spores from circulating.

Attic and basement mold treatment - treating hidden areas prone to excess moisture and mold growth.

Moisture assessment - identifying sources of excess humidity that contribute to mold problems.

Mold Control Questions

What causes mold growth in homes? Mold can develop due to excess moisture from leaks, high humidity, or poor ventilation.

How can mold be identified? Visible patches, musty odors, or signs of water damage may indicate mold presence.

Are mold control treatments safe for my property? Treatments are designed to be safe and effective for residential environments when properly performed.

What types of mold issues are common in residential properties? Common issues include mold growth on walls, ceilings, basements, and around windows or plumbing fixtures.
